Scheduling Coordinator (Hybrid - Cary, NC)

Remote, USA Full-time
Acentra Health is dedicated to empowering better health outcomes through technology and clinical expertise. The Scheduling Coordinator will ensure timely assessments for Medicaid beneficiaries by facilitating communication and coordination between beneficiaries, providers, and assessors, contributing to the efficiency of services. Responsibilities Utilize automated systems to schedule assessments for completion by Registered Nurses for both in-home and facility settings, in line with contracted metrics and deliverables Ensure accurate and timely documentation of all interactions during the scheduling process within both the states and proprietary systems Initiate outbound communication with beneficiaries and providers to efficiently schedule all assessments for completion and ensure routing efficiency Respond to inquiries and requests regarding assessments, scheduling conflicts, and complaints, providing prompt and effective resolutions Develop and maintain a thorough understanding of internal policies, procedures, and services, both departmental and operational Consult with the supervisor on complex or unresolved issues and precedent-setting decisions to ensure appropriate resolution Strong attention to detail, ensuring accuracy in all tasks Read, understand, and adhere to all corporate policies including policies related to HIPAA and its Privacy and Security Rules Skills High school diploma or GED equivalent 1+ years of customer service experience within the healthcare industry 1+ years' scheduling experience 1+ years' experience in an outbound calling (Call Center) Demonstrated professionalism, flexibility, and dependability under pressure, with the ability to work independently with minimal supervision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, along with strong interpersonal, organizational, and time management abilities Proficiency in Microsoft Office programs, along with access to high-speed internet and a secure, private work environment free from distractions Benefits Comprehensive health plans Paid time off Retirement savings Corporate wellness Educational assistance Corporate discounts Company Overview Acentra Health is a provider of clinical services and technological solutions to government healthcare organizations.
